The Watch Command Log is a daily summary of events of significance compiled by Watch Commanders. There are three watches in a 24-hour period: days, afternoons and graveyards. Items contained in the Watch Command Log are based on information available at the time of its release and should not be interpreted as an admission or finding of guilt. Arrest information may differ from formal charges filed by the prosecuting agency.

DAY SHIFT

0646

Taser Deployment

511 W. 200 S.

12-205322

Officers responded to a Domestic Violence call at the above address. While they were interviewing the involved persons an intoxicated male adult kept interfering, refusing officers repeated commands to move away. He resisted officer’s attempts to take him into custody and was tased.  He was found to have been concealing a loaded handgun. Kollen T. Rice (5-21-87) was booked on several outstanding arrest warrants and multiple charges.

AFTERNOON SHIFT

1915

Recovered Stolen/ Plan C

1400 W. 300 S.

12-205692

An officer attempted a routine traffic stop and the vehicle fled.  Officers found it abandoned at 256 S. 1400 W. and determined it had been stolen. Officers set up containment and deployed a K-9 team.  Four of the vehicle occupants were eventually located. Hung Nguyen (5/14/93) was booked into jail for on a warrant and fleeing. A female juvenile was booked into Detention for a pickup order, drug paraphernalia, and fleeing. Two other juveniles were released, charges screened. The male adult driver of the stolen vehicle got away but has been identified.
